Teenagers and young adults are the most likely to have orthodontic dental treatment. Many parents came under pressure from their kids who want to wear braces and looks good.

It is obvious that for better result the treatment should be done at an early age. The only drawback that makes the parents step back is the cost of the treatment. On average expect to spend about $4000 to $6000 on orthodontic treatment.

Does orthodontic dental insurance coverage exist?

Yes orthodontic dental insurance is meant to takes care the cost of orthodontic procedures,equipments and general orthodontic care. If you already have dental insurance, your policy might included orthodontic coverage already. If your policy do not cover orthodontic then you may need a supplementary form of dental orthodontic insurance in order to cover your costs. This is very true if you have family members that need braces or orthodontic work.

How does the orthodontic coverage works?

Just like your regular health or dental insurance coverage,you will be required to pay for the monthly or yearly premium. Your insurance company would normally pay for the orthodontic care up to a maximum amount. How much is the maximum amount covered and what percentage that your provider would pay depend on your insurance plan and insurance company. Some insurance companies will insured up to 50% of the orthodontic care costs.

What makes orthodontic dental insurance a necessity?

As mentioned above, orthodontic care expenses can run into thousands of dollars per year or until the completion of the treatment.If you have a few family members that need the treatment at the same time, this could be quite a financial burden.

Why do regular dental care is cheaper than orthodontic care?

The chunk of the expense are from the equipment cost such as braces,retainers and other additional products. Also the costs of dental x-rays, regular monthly checkups and adjustments that would need to be made.

All of this expenses contribute to the high cost of orthodontic care.

The basic dental plan on average would need the provider to only cover up to certain amount of dental care per year. You have to be responsible for all of your dental cost for any amount above the maximum yearly amount. The cost of braces alone could cost more than $1000 for orthodontic treatment. That’s the obvious reason a basic dental coverage do not include orthodontic care. Most of the times orthodontic procedures are regard as dental cosmetic. As a result many insurance providers do not offer coverage for orthodontic work.
